Using dent pulling tools In general this repair process is rather basic. Basically, a service technician or person will use a PDR glue and a dent pulling tool to remove the dent. The individual typically puts the glue on the front-side of the car body panels and after that uses a dent puller to take out one side of that glue in order to develop stress.

This process is repeated until there are no more noticeable repair work. A reflector board is utilized to ensure that the panel is flat. If you are trying to get rid of a dent yourself, it's best to attempt to use paintless dent repair tools with very little pressure when possible. It can be appealing to attempt and pry out big dents rapidly, however this could trigger more damage than excellent sometimes.

When the dent is situated on an automobile body panel, it can be pushed outwards by this tool. Likewise, the PDR rods are normally used to repair the hail damage dents. Routine individuals have the ability to utilize this tool without any aid from an automobile body store. With the help of a reflector board, you can discover a dent and rise on the metal with minimal force.

Some people have expressed issue with paintless dent repair, as they think that a car's paint will be harmed if the tool is used improperly. Is paintless dent repair covered by insurance? The concern is made complex and depends on your individual situations. Insurance suppliers will frequently cover the impact repair expenses of fixing damages through insurance coverage if it was brought on by an accident or theft.

Comprehensive coverage typically covers paintless dent repair, and the expense for this can be discovered by calling your insurance coverage supplier. Additionally, to include this coverage to your policy, you're going to have to call your insurer or representative also. How long does paintless dent repair take? Paintless dent repair is made complex, and it can take a very long time.

It can take from a few hours to a few days to fix a smaller sized dent and might take up to four days for bigger damage. This is without taking into account if your cars and truck requires a touch-up when it concerns paint work.
